Hey future maintainers — this is the Bramblewick bloom filter sitting in front of the Korvo KV store. Quick handover from me (Dell) to Priya. False-positive rate tuned to ~1%; resize job runs nightly and rebuilds from the WAL, so don't panic if memory spikes at 02:00. The counting-filter branch is half-done — see the notes in the wiki. If the rebuild job wedges and you need the ops vault, the recovery passphrase is right below this line.

unlock words, yawig-kagef: gordor-holvan-ulaael-pramir-ulaiel-tamdor

## Ownership: Soft Deletes (orders table)

Orders in Cartwheel are never hard-deleted. Rows get a deleted_at timestamp; the purge job hard-removes them after 180 days. Do not write queries that ignore deleted_at — use the provided scoped views. If the purge job stalls, restart it once; if it stalls again, page the owning team, not DBA. Schema changes to this table require sign-off from the designated table owner.

signatory, tadup-fahog: Zorwyn Keleth

**Q: A user's session token keeps refreshing in a loop after the Quillbase 4.2 update. What do I do?**

This is a known bug in the Quillbase token service: the refresh endpoint occasionally issues an already-expired token, forcing an immediate retry. Revoke the user's active sessions from the Lanterloo admin console, then re-seed their auth record. That re-seeding step requires the team recovery passphrase, which is listed here.

strongbox words: norwyn-wenael-aldvan-aldiel-wendor-holael

## Releases

Mistrelay's websocket layer ships with permessage-deflate enabled by default, but each release notes the memory-versus-bandwidth tradeoff explicitly. Compression saves roughly 60% bandwidth on chatty payloads while adding per-connection context overhead, so builds targeting constrained gateways disable it at compile time. Future maintainers should re-run the soak benchmarks before changing defaults, and document results in the release notes. All release archives are signed; verify them with the key below before promoting to stable.

signing key of bagap-yawep = bky13_TbfT6ZMUoGJo2